Danny joins John Bonham Tribute

Danny has been added to a lineup of drummers that will pay tribute to John Bonham at the Key Club in Hollywood this month.  On the 25th of September Danny will join the following drummers:

  • Steven Adler (GUNS N’ ROSES, ADLER’S APPETITE)
  • Vinny Appice (BLACK SABBATH, HEAVEN & HELL)
  • Kenny Aronoff (JOHN COUGAR, JOHN FOGERTY)
  • Frankie Banali (QUIET RIOT)
  • Bobby Blotzer (RATT)
  • Jason Bonham (LED ZEPPELIN, FOREIGNER)
  • Fred Coury (CINDERELLA)
  • Jimmy D’Anda (BULLETBOYS)
  • James Kottak (SCORPIONS)
  • Abe Laboriel (PAUL MCCARTNEY)
  • Khurt Maier (SALTY DOG)
  • Stephen Perkins (JANE’S ADDICTION)
  • Chris Slade (THE FIRM, AC/DC)
  • Chad Smith (RED HOT CHILI PEPPERS, CHICKENFOOT)
  • Brian Tichy (WHITESNAKE, FOREIGNER, BILLY IDOL)
  • Joe Travers (ZAPPA PLAYS ZAPPA, DURAN DURAN)
  • Simon Wright (AC/DC, DIO)
  • Zoe Bonham
  • Danny Carey (TOOL)
  • Deborah Bonham

Each drummer plays their own Zeppelin song apparently.  No word on what Zeppelin song Danny will perform, but perhaps it’ll be No Quarter.
